Greater Houston ASNT at a glance

What we know about Greater Houston ASNT

What they do

The Greater Houston section of the American Society for Non-destructive Testing (GHASNT) is the world's largest and most active local section with a membership of over 1000 non-destructive testing (NDT) professionals. Our section provides a forum for the exchange of NDT related technical information as well as exceptional opportunities for peer networking for technicians, management, engineers, students and others working in the NDT community. Automated Technical Inquiry Resolution for NDT Standards

GHASNT manages a high volume of technical queries regarding NDT standards, codes, and methodologies. Manual responses create bottlenecks that delay professional development and project timelines. By deploying an AI agent trained on historical technical forums and industry standards, the organization can provide immediate, accurate, and context-aware responses to members. This reduces the burden on volunteer subject matter experts and ensures consistent, high-quality information delivery, which is critical for maintaining safety and compliance standards in the energy sector.

Up to 50% reduction in manual query response timeIndustry Association Digital Transformation Survey
The agent acts as a specialized knowledge retrieval system. It ingests technical documentation, past forum discussions, and regulatory updates. When a member submits a query, the agent parses the request, performs a vector search across the knowledge base, and drafts a response citing relevant NDT standards. It integrates with existing communication platforms to provide real-time assistance, escalating only complex, novel issues to human experts.

Automated Compliance and Certification Tracking

NDT professionals operate under strict certification requirements that must be tracked and renewed regularly. For an organization of this size, managing these records manually is error-prone and labor-intensive. Automating certification tracking ensures that members remain compliant with industry standards, reducing the risk of professional liability and maintaining the integrity of the local NDT community. This automation allows staff to focus on high-value community building rather than administrative data entry.

30% reduction in administrative processing timeProfessional Association Operational Efficiency Study
The agent integrates with the membership database to monitor certification expiry dates. It automatically sends personalized renewal reminders, guides members through the submission process, and flags missing documentation. The agent interfaces with external certification databases where possible to verify status, ensuring that the local records remain accurate and up-to-date without human intervention.

Will AI adoption impact our compliance with industry safety standards?
AI agents act as support tools, not decision-makers, for critical safety-related NDT tasks. They are configured to follow human-in-the-loop protocols, where the agent provides data and recommendations, but final verification of compliance with standards like ASME or API remains with qualified human professionals. By automating the tracking and dissemination of these standards, AI actually improves compliance by reducing the risk of human error in documentation and scheduling.
